Basic facts about this digital color

#D3AF4C falls into the Orange Color Family — High Saturation,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(211, 175, 76) — 82.7% red, 68.6% green, 29.8%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 0 / 14 / 53 / 17.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

The color #D3AF4C reads as a strongly colored warm orange and carries an easy, daylight feel. Expect to see shades like this in logos, highlights and anything that needs to be noticed first.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Antique Gold Metallic (#CFA94A). Slightly further away sit Fish N Chips (#DCAB4B) and Rob Roy (#DDAD56).

The recipe behind #D3AF4C is rgb(211, 175, 76), with red as the dominant ingredient. On this background, black text reaches a 10.0: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AAA); white stays at 2.1:1. #D3AF4C color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
